Transaction 20585bcd774b63fec160c7fc96f9f7cd31523dca02b7d78a77f65ef38baa5790

1 Input
2 Outputs
  • 20585bcd774b63fec160c7fc96f9f7cd31523dca02b7d78a77f65ef38baa5790:0
  • value  1820038393
    address  1EvmPBA2u4ca386c3mxRGgwT21oczpPXB
  • 20585bcd774b63fec160c7fc96f9f7cd31523dca02b7d78a77f65ef38baa5790:1
  • value  404900
    address  1N3w6FhVwzC3B2ZMqCx6jyKdpAQqpo5xPs